Taurus Molecular Cloud-II :

Optics: Takahashi FSQ-106EDXIII F/5 530mm. - APO Refractor
Mount: AP Mach1 GTO
Camera: Moravian G4-16000 Mark II
Filters: Astrodon E Series Gen II LRGB 50mm squared
Guiding Systems: SX Lodestar
Dates/Times: December 2019
Location: Pragelato - Turin - Italy
Exposure Details: L:R:G:B => 575:63:63:63 = > (115x5):(21x3):(21x3):(21x3) Color Bin2 [num x minutes]
Cooling Details: -25 °C
Acquisition: Voyager Astrophotography Automation
Processing: CCDStack2+, PixInsight, PS CC
Mean FWHM: 1.10 / 2.34
SQM-L: 20.67 / 21.11
